Technical Specifications

Parameters and characteristics for this part

SpecificationSRK2001TR
ApplicationsSynchronous Rectifier, Secondary-Side Controller
Current - Supply35 mA
Mounting TypeSurface Mount
Operating Temperature [Max]125 °C
Operating Temperature [Min]-25 °C
Package / Case0.154 in, 3.9 mm
Package / Case10-SOP
Supplier Device Package10-SSOP
Voltage - Supply [Max]32 VDC
Voltage - Supply [Min]4.5 V

Description

General part information

SRK2001 Series

The SRK2001 controller implements a control scheme specific for secondary side synchronous rectification in LLC resonant converters that use a transformer with center tap secondary winding for full wave rectification.

It provides two high current gate drive outputs, each capable of directly driving one or more N-channel power MOSFET. Each gate driver is controlled separately and an interlock logic circuit prevents the two synchronous rectifier MOSFET from conducting simultaneously.

The control scheme ensures that each synchronous rectifier is switched ON as the corresponding half-winding starts conducting and OFF as its current falls to zero.
